Saccobolus beckii?
Joop van der Lee,
08-04-2019 18:57
Found on deer dung,Perithecia: 192 um diameter.
Asci: 8- spored; 100-111.5x26.5-32.5 um
Spore cluster: 47.9-53.6x22.5-25.4 um
Spores: 19.4-19.8x9.7-10.4 um; at first hyaline than black and covered with coarse warts and/or plaques; thickness of layer 1.6-2.9 um
Paraphyses: septated; 2.5-3.8 um
